SHIFT_JISX0213 decoding may hang on crafted input

Converting crafted SHIFT_JISX0213 input to UCS-4 or the internal wide character encoding, for example with iconv, in the GNU C Library version 2.3 to 2.44 may result in the converter making no progress, causing the calling application to hang. Some SHIFT_JISX0213 sequences decode to two code points. If the output buffer has room for only the first one, the converter stores the second in the conversion state and returns E2BIG, but it never clears that pending character after emitting it on the next call. The converter then keeps emitting the pending character without consuming further input, so an application that retries the conversion loops forever. The input must be attacker controlled and the application must convert it with an output buffer small enough to split the two code points. Only the SHIFT_JISX0213 character set is affected, which is not commonly used. The related defect in the EUC_JISX0213 converter is tracked separately as CVE-2026-80489.
